Shiba Inu goes big on BIGG Digital

March 29, 2022 by Aishwarya shashikumar

Shiba Inu (SHIB) is now accessible on Netcoins, an online cryptocurrency exchange that makes it simple for Canadians to buy, trade, and hodl cryptocurrency, according to a press release. Netcoins claims itself as Canada’s first fully regulated publicly owned cryptocurrency exchange platform.

Netcoins, a division of BIGG Digital Assets Inc, recently got clearance for an update to its constrained dealer license, allowing the platform to provide a wider range of coins. Shiba Inu, DOGE, MATIC, FTM, and MANA were among the five new coins added to the platform.

Netcoins obtained clearance for an amendment to its restricted dealer license on 24 March 2022, which was requested in late 2021 and will allow the platform to provide a wider range of coins. These five coins are the first in a series of coin enhancements that will be released in the following months.

Apart from the new additions, the cryptocurrency exchange also accepts Bitcoin (BTC), Bitcoin Cash (BCH), Ethereum (ETH), Litecoin (LTC), XRP (XRP), and Stellar (XLM). Netcoins, which was founded in 2014 and is based in Canada, presently services customers in Canada but is seeking to expand to the United States.

Shiba Inu, DOGE, MATIC, FTM, and MANA contributed 12 percent of daily revenue shortly after introduction, according to Mark Binns, Netcoins CEO.

Shiba Inu and its offspring introduced to online shopping

John Richmond, a leading apparel manufacturer, has taken another step further in Shiba Inu adoption by introducing SHIB and LEASH burns for its online store. Every purchase made using NOWPayments will result in the burning of 9% Shib and 1% Leash. The fashion brand tweeted, on 26 March 2022,

“More Partnershibs? Here we are coming in hot! We are proud to accept and burn SHIB and LEASH for our online shop at @Johmrichmond. 9% Shib & 1% Leash will be burned for every purchase through @NOWPayments_io.”

In a similar vein, three companies have joined the SHIB burning fad through NOWPayments. SHIB and Doge Killer (LEASH) are now being tested on the aforementioned platform’s burning gateway. Welly’s Italian burger company, John Richmond apparel brand, and Sorbillo’s pizza chain will use NOWPayments to burn a portion of their SHIB revenues.

Screenshot 22

The @shibburn tracker has announced on Twitter that a total of 7,703,474 SHIB tokens were burned in six transactions in the last 24 hours. Over 2,604,802,620 SHIB tokens have been burned in the last seven days, with 191 trades.
